Minimizing the appearance of scars

Any advice on what to use to minimize the appearance of scars? I haven't had surgery yet but just thinking about what u all have done? Any creams or methods that you've used to minimize them?

I don't have pictures, but will take one for you to see what the scars look like 3 months out. They are much smaller than immediately post surgery already, so I don't think they are going to be noticeable after a year or so. I know my tubal scars were pretty much gone after about 2 years. The key is to make sure your surgeon is using skin glue instead of sutures for the skin layer when he closes. Generally they do, but it doesn't hurt to ask before surgery.

i am 6 months out and my biggest scar was about 2 inches long and is a very faint pink now..barely noticable...the other4 incisions, you cant even see. truthfully, its not really worrying about.

I had 5 incisions. By 3 months post op I could only see 2.... And sometime in the last 24 months those have also disappeared. I didn't use anything.

Now that I have had my tummy tuck I will be buying some merdema cream to help this one along since it's hip to hip...but the dr said it should fade on its on within a year since I am past the collagen producing years.... But I am not taking any chances....lol
